  • What will I study?

    So, you’ve mastered basic excel but you want to learn more about the application and delve a little deeper into its functionality:

    Module 1

    Customise quick access toolbar, database rules, Sort a database, multiple sorting, find and replace data

    Module 2

    Using the dataform, autofilter, conditional criteria, top 10fFilters, advanced filters

    Module 3

    Text to columns, merge cell data, database functions, formula and command linking, linking workbooks, hyperlinking

    Module 4

    Protect sheets, protect cells, protect workbook, freeze panes, working with comments
